Well, Happy Holidays!

I traveled about 10 miles from home to attend Thanksgiving dinner at a fellow BMW lover's home, and, upon leaving, and/or arriving home, I was so joyed to discover that the following lights were inoperable in my coupe:

- side marker lights: left and right, front and back
- tail lights: left and right
- under-hood light
- instrument cluster illumination
- custom guage set illumination (lighting wired into stock cluster lighting)

I have been laid up with a severe cold/sinus condition for some 7 weeks now, and today was the first chance I have had to even look at my coupe since Thanksgiving. Here's what I have verified as working:

- head lights: high and low (low/high)
- tail lights: left and right
- directional parking lights (operated by turn signal stalk when car is parked - European delivery option): front and rear 
- back-up lights: left and right
- trunk light
- brake lights: left, center (I added one to my package shelf), and right
- instrument idiot lights
- fuel guage
- water temp guage
- custom guage cluster guages: oil pressure, water temp, ammeter
- heater blower fan
- wipers: intermittent, low, high
- wiper washers
- cigar lighter
- radio
- interior courtesy light

The coupe starts and runs per normal, which is very well now, as I added a Pertronics ignition in August.  All fuses (all glass) pass smell, sight and continuity tests.  Looking at my wiring schematics, I have deduced:

1.  The inoperable lighting is all driven off fuses 1, 2, and/or 3.  But, these fused are all "OK".
2.  Many, but not all (front marker lights, under-hood light, instrument lights) lights share a common ground in the rear trunk wall.
3.  ALL, as in ALL, of the inoperable lights are controlled by the main light switch (first detent), and none of the working lights are!!

So, methinks that I have a faulty light switch.  The switch is original (125K on the car).  Can't say I have operated this switch but maybe two dozen times since purchasing the coupe in 1999. What do you people think about this situation?
